Output 6f095c392d09a7c8506d7e36a388c6752f21a94aaea4491b018b8b7c99cb0026:0

value
43630
script pubkey
OP_0 OP_PUSHBYTES_20 ddfdbea4e19e619271e2eac300072e4daae96fe1
address
bc1qmh7maf8pneseyu0zatpsqpewfk4wjmlpzchx7r
transaction
6f095c392d09a7c8506d7e36a388c6752f21a94aaea4491b018b8b7c99cb0026
spent
true